Problem: A process A wants to send a dataset of 3 MB to a process B using a message passing mechanism. Estimate the total time required to complete the transfer in each of the following cases, with the performance assumptions listed below:

a. Using connectionless (datagram) communication (for example, UDP);

b. Using connection-oriented communication (TCP);

c. When the two processes are on the same machine.

Latency per packet (remote, incurred on both send and receive): 5 ms

Latency per packet (local, incurred on both send and receive): 2 ms

Connection setup time (TCP only): 5 ms

Data transfer rate: 10 Mbps

Maximum transfer unit (max packet length): 1000 bytes.
